HCG LEVEL CAN ANYONE HELP?

ok i had m y hcg level checked the day before yesterday and it was 68 and had it checked again less then 24 hr later and it was 82 are those normal levels early in preganancy?I UNDERSTAND  that they go by ur LMP which would have been the 22nd of june and that would make me 5 weeks 3 days but i know that im def not that far because the first time i had unprotected sex was the 5th of july and again around the 8th so that would only be 21 days ago so would those levels be ok

Don't have an ultrasound until you are at least 5 weeks from the July 5 date when you first had the unprotected sex.  You don't want to freak yourself out by not seeing anything, and it is definitely possible to have an ultrasound too early to see something and go home crying because nothing showed up, when you really were fine.

I would not have had another hCG draw less than 24 hours after the first one.  You are needing to know your rate of rise in 48 hours, and while the trajectory sounds OK, it would have been clearer if you had just had the second draw after the 48-hour mark.  If you can just go get a blood draw any time you want, get one today, and you'll have a 48-hour rate of rise.

It sounds like you probably conceived when you think you did, and your levels are normal for that timeline.

Even at 5 weeks you can have a level as low as like 5 and still be pregnant. Its not what your level is but that it doubles in 48-72 hours. I had a level of 48 at 4 weeks and now am almost 30 weeks. Also, it looks like hour levels are rising well. Congrats on your pregnancy!
